Scalability Is Where Divi Shines

One of Divi’s biggest strengths is its ability to scale as your business grows. Whether you’re starting with a simple brochure site or planning to expand into eCommerce, Divi handles it all.

  • WooCommerce Ready: Seamless integration with WooCommerce means you can start small and expand into online sales without switching platforms.
  • Modular Design Systems: I build sites with smart layouts, reusable sections, and global design settings so you’re set up for growth.
  • Future-Proof Structure: With clean content architecture and flexible theme builder tools, adding new services, pages, or functionality is smooth—not a teardown.
